Core Viewpoint - The article discusses the rapid decline of the well-known bagged tea brand CHALI, which was once considered a rising star in the industry but is now facing bankruptcy and numerous lawsuits due to financial mismanagement and strategic failures [3][30]. Group 1: Debt and Legal Issues - CHALI has been embroiled in debt disputes, with employees seeking unpaid wages for over a year, leading to widespread attention and legal actions [5][6]. - As of January 2026, CHALI is involved in over 120 lawsuits, with its executives facing restrictions on consumption and the company owing nearly 200 million yuan [8][9]. - Despite its legal troubles, CHALI continues to operate its flagship stores on e-commerce platforms, with some products still achieving high sales volumes [10][11]. Group 2: Previous Success and Investment - Before its crisis, CHALI was seen as a capital darling, achieving significant sales milestones and raising substantial funding through multiple financing rounds, including a billion yuan in B-round financing in 2021 [12][15]. - The company had backing from notable investors, including Country Garden and JD Technology, and was viewed as a potential competitor to established brands like Lipton [17][18]. Group 3: Strategic Failures - CHALI's ambitious foray into the bottled tea market, seen as a critical growth area, ultimately led to its downfall due to underestimating market competition and overextending its resources [19][20]. - The company invested heavily in building a bottled tea factory and marketing campaigns, but faced high costs and poor product reception, leading to significant financial losses [22][24]. - Sales in the bottled tea segment resulted in losses of several million yuan in the first half of 2023, while its core bagged tea sales plummeted by 69.7% year-on-year, with online sales dropping to around 30 million yuan [25][28]. Group 4: Conclusion - The story of CHALI illustrates the risks of rapid expansion fueled by capital without adequate attention to cash flow and market realities, highlighting the challenges faced by companies in the competitive beverage industry [30][31].

Core Viewpoint - Weidi Electronics plans to acquire at least 51% of the voting rights of Jiu Xing Precision Technology through a cash purchase, aiming to gain control of the company [1] Group 1: Acquisition Details - The acquisition will be executed in two steps: first, acquiring 51% of the shares from the controlling shareholder, Jiangsu Zhiyue Tiancheng Enterprise Management Co., Ltd.; second, purchasing shares from other shareholders [1] - The transaction will not involve issuing new shares, thus avoiding dilution of existing shareholders' interests and will not change the control of Weidi Electronics [1][2] Group 2: Strategic Rationale - The acquisition is aligned with Weidi Electronics' long-term strategic needs and is expected to enhance the company's business scale, profitability, and overall asset quality [2] - The cash acquisition model allows for quick control without the complexities of share issuance, making it suitable for companies looking to enter new markets while maintaining strategic flexibility [2] Group 3: Company Background and Market Context - Jiu Xing Precision has a diverse shareholding structure, with Jiangsu Zhiyue Tiancheng as the largest shareholder at 46.12%, and focuses on precision metal components for high-end home appliances [3] - Weidi Electronics, a leader in commercial vehicle electronic control systems, is facing operational pressure, with a reported revenue of 110 million yuan and a net profit decline of 80.11% year-on-year for the first three quarters of 2025 [3] Group 4: Industry Challenges and Opportunities - The traditional automotive electronics sector is experiencing challenges due to technological gaps and value chain restructuring, prompting Weidi Electronics to diversify into the high-margin consumer sector through this acquisition [4] - The integration of home appliance components with automotive electronics could enhance overall profitability and risk resilience, although challenges in supply chain management and technology integration remain [5]

Core Viewpoint - The recent share reduction by multiple executives at Jing Sheng Mechanical & Electrical (晶盛机电) raises concerns about the company's internal dynamics and future performance, especially as it navigates its transition into the semiconductor industry [2][5]. Executive Share Reduction - On October 17, Jing Sheng Mechanical & Electrical announced that five executives, including Vice President Zhu Liang, plan to reduce their holdings by up to 2.776 million shares, representing 0.21% of the total share capital excluding repurchased shares [2][4]. - The total estimated cash from this share reduction is approximately 113 million yuan, with Zhu Liang expected to cash out around 43.88 million yuan [4]. Reasons for Share Reduction - The company stated that the share reduction is primarily due to the executives' personal financial needs, as they have not sold shares since 2019 and have participated in two stock incentive programs [5]. - The shares being sold are mainly from stock incentives, except for Zhu Liang's shares, which are from the company's initial public offering [5]. Company Performance and Market Reaction - Following the announcement, the company's stock price fell by 7.62%, closing at 37.71 yuan per share, resulting in a market capitalization of 49.4 billion yuan, with a loss of nearly 13 billion yuan from its peak on October 9 [5]. - The company reported a significant decline in revenue and net profit for the first half of the year, with revenue down 42.85% to 5.799 billion yuan and net profit down 69.52% to 639 million yuan, attributed to the cyclical downturn in the photovoltaic industry [7]. Semiconductor Business Development - Jing Sheng Mechanical & Electrical has been expanding into the semiconductor sector, with products including semiconductor equipment and materials, and has achieved domestic production of 8-12 inch silicon wafer equipment [6]. - The company has a significant order backlog in integrated circuit and compound semiconductor equipment contracts exceeding 3.7 billion yuan, although the execution of these orders is expected to take time [7]. Investment in Other Companies - The company confirmed that its controlling shareholder indirectly holds shares in Moole Technology through an investment fund, but denied any direct or indirect investment in Moole Technology itself [8].

Core Viewpoint - Haichang New Materials plans to acquire 51% equity of Shenzhen Xinwei Communication Technology Co., Ltd. for 255 million yuan, marking a significant cross-industry expansion into the satellite positioning and communication sector [1][2]. Group 1: Acquisition Details - The acquisition involves a cash payment of 255 million yuan for 51% equity in the target company, which specializes in GNSS antenna positioning and related components [2]. - The audited financials of the target company for 2024 indicate total assets of 80.3 million yuan, total liabilities of 35.6 million yuan, and a net profit of 30.4 million yuan [2]. - The transferor has committed to a performance guarantee, ensuring that the target company achieves a cumulative net profit of no less than 120 million yuan over the years 2025 to 2027 [2]. Group 2: Strategic Implications - This acquisition represents a strategic move for Haichang New Materials, which has traditionally focused on powder metallurgy products, to diversify into high-tech sectors [3]. - The integration of the target company's satellite positioning technology with Haichang's existing products is expected to enhance capabilities in applications such as drones and electric vehicles [3]. - The merger is anticipated to optimize production and supply chain resources, leveraging Haichang's overseas presence to support the target company's international growth strategy [3]. Group 3: Transaction Status - The signed intention agreement is a framework agreement and does not guarantee the completion of the acquisition, indicating potential uncertainties in finalizing the transaction [4].
